Output e26d8d1040bd139f1a24bbf58dd9b2b24b122e947c3da48e32a56b2cb95f6908:17

value
44958
script pubkey
OP_0 OP_PUSHBYTES_20 e856531ac5f0cf4514e6c2fc3093d6a7ad194152
address
bc1qapt9xxk97r85298xct7rpy7k57k3js2jcxfxxy
transaction
e26d8d1040bd139f1a24bbf58dd9b2b24b122e947c3da48e32a56b2cb95f6908
spent
true